Wikipedia
Wordwell is a small village in Suffolk about five miles North of Bury St Edmunds. The village was hit badly by the Black Death in 1348 and never really seems to have recovered in terms of population. During the 19th and early 20th centuries it was part of the Culford Estate. The Church is largely Norman but with Victorian alterations. Wordwell is also one of very few Thankful Villages, that is to say one which lost no men during either World Wars.
